6.3 Reset unit
Resetting to first start-up
By resetting to first start-up, all system pa-
rameters are set to the state upon delivery of
the project.
Î Press the reset key on the back of the de-
vice.
Restoring the system
The "Restore system" command in "Settings"
allows the system to be restored to a certain
point. Once set, settings can be reset to this
point again at any time.
Î Go to the main menu (
Î Select "Restore system" in "Settings".
